    My daughter has danced at Protege Dance Company for 8 years.  She has been a part of the recreational program as well as the competitive program. Recreational students are in a great, safe environment.  They learn both dance skills and life skills, self confidence, and they develop good friends. As a part of the competitive team they also learn much more about team work, discipline and perseverance. The quality of the teachers is excellent.   Whether recreational or competitive,  the teaching is very consistent from year to year. Protege Dance Company is a fun, inclusive,  safe, and encouraging atmosphere for your child.
